Transaction 37941c36ca5aebc7ab11c019719e626a74f66bd365af168c7a09be680c4c79ac
1 Input
1 Output
-
37941c36ca5aebc7ab11c019719e626a74f66bd365af168c7a09be680c4c79ac:0
- value
- 2723664686793
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 77fd4f60c15372bbfb30227b03644b08f0d3c4d03015defa376bd5da358eb649
- address
- ltc1gwl757cxp2deth7esyfasxeztprcd83xsxq2aa73hd02a5dvwkeysxw62fe